Hotel Boutique Portal De Cantuña, in Quito's historic center, offers guests a complimentary full breakfast each morning. Enjoy midday refreshments at the coffee shop and city views from the rooftop terrace. On-site laundry facilities and bike rentals add convenience for visitors.
Located in Quito, Hotel Boutique Portal De Cantuña is in the city centre. Plaza de San Francisco and Maria Augusta Urrutia Museum are local landmarks, and some of the area's attractions include Quito Eterno and El Centro Cultural Metropolitano. Nayon Xtreme Valley and Centro de Arte Contemporaneo are also worth visiting. Take the opportunity to explore the area for outdoor excitement like hiking/biking trails. Visit our Quito travel guide
You can look forward to free full breakfast, a terrace and a coffee shop/cafe at Hotel Boutique Portal De Cantuña. In addition to a hair salon and laundry facilities, guests can connect to free in-room WiFi.

You may be required to pay the following charge at the property: Ecuador value-added tax (VAT) at 15%. A VAT exemption is available to travellers who present a valid passport and tourist visa showing that they are not a resident of Ecuador.

Very well located hotel in the centro historico
The hotel in a colonial house in Quito's centro historico is interesting and couldn't be better located. The family and staff who run it were delightful and very kind and helpful. A drawback was that the restaurant where breakfast was served, was open to the outside and so chilly it was difficult to enjoy the good breakfast that was provided. The room we occupied, had no window to the outside and as a result was somewhat claustrophobic and was also very chilly (but this is not unusual for the area). Generally a good experience.
